Tuxpan, Jalisco, Mexico
Overview
Tuxpan is a picturesque city in southern Jalisco, Mexico, known for its friendly locals, lively agricultural markets, and charming colonial architecture. The city blends rural traditions with modern conveniences, making it an inviting destination for those seeking authenticity and tranquility.
Best Time to Visit
November to March for dry, mild weather and local festivals.
Local Tips
Carry cash since some smaller shops don't accept cards. Try local specialties like birria and raicilla for an authentic taste of the region.
Cultural Etiquette
Tipping 10-15% is appreciated in restaurants. Dress is casual but respectful, especially in churches or government buildings. Greet people with a friendly buenos días.
Safety Warnings
Centro and main suburbs are generally safe, but avoid walking alone at night in isolated areas and be cautious with valuables in crowded markets. No significant scams reported, but stay alert in transportation hubs.
Hidden Gems
Visit El Parián for authentic local food, the Sierra de Quila reserve for hiking, and the small artisan workshops selling handmade ceramics and sweets.
